PURPOSE:
The Florida Department of Transportation (FDOT) proposes to construct intersection improvements at State Road 436 (Semoran Boulevard) and University Boulevard/Scarlet Road. This Locally Funded Agreement is intended to upgrade the traffic signals for the subject project from strain poles to mast arms. Orange County shall be responsible, in perpetuity, for the preventive and periodic maintenance of the mast arm signals, as stated in the Amendment to the Traffic Signal Maintenance and Compensation Agreement, Contract ARX38, dated October 4, 2016, and as amended from time to time.
After construction is complete, The County agrees to inspect, maintain, repair and replace the mast arms in perpetuity in accordance with the terms of the Traffic Signal Maintenance and Compensation Agreement previously signed by the parties hereto and as specified in the LFA, Exhibit “A”, Scope of Services. The parties agree that, upon installation, the mast arm structures shall be owned by FDOT, and FDOT shall always be entitled to inspect the mast arm structures. The County agrees that it will, on or before but no later than September 15, 2026, furnish FDOT an advance deposit in the amount of $237,307, for full payment of the estimated additional project cost for Locally Funded project number 451256-1-52-02.
